Dietitian note

Chocolate, especially dark chocolate, can be a trigger for GERD symptoms. Caffeine and Theobromine, both found in chocolate, can relax the lower esophageal sphincter (LES). This muscle acts as a barrier between the esophagus and stomach. When relaxed, it allows stomach acid to flow back up into the esophagus, causing heartburn. The high fat content in chocolate can also contribute to GERD symptoms by slowing down digestion and relaxing the LES.

Ingredients

Almonds, Sunflower Kernels, Avocado Oil, Honey, Fair Trade Semi-sweet Chocolate (cane Sugar, Unsweetened Chocolate, Cocoa Butter, Dextrose, Sunflower Lecithin), Dried Cranberries (cranberries, Sugar, Rice Flour), Sunflower Lecithin, Sea Salt, Ground Vanilla, Rosemary Extract (flavorless, To Preserve Freshness). Contains: Almonds.
